Overview

Controller expansion boards are auxiliary modules that interface with primary control units like PLCs, Arduino, or Raspberry Pi to add specialized functions. They address limitations in built-in ports or processing power, enabling customization for industrial, IoT, or prototyping applications. Common variants include relay boards, motor drivers, and analog signal converters. Manufacturers often design these boards for specific ecosystems (e.g., Arduino shields) with standardized connectors for seamless integration.

Structure and Working Principle

A typical expansion board comprises a printed circuit board (PCB) with integrated circuits, connectors, and passive components. It interfaces with the host controller via GPIO pins, USB, or proprietary slots, drawing power either from the controller or an external supply. The board translates or amplifies signals between the controller and peripherals. For example, a CAN bus expansion board converts UART signals to CAN protocol for automotive networks, while ADC boards digitize analog sensor inputs for microcontrollers.

Key Features

Modern expansion boards emphasize plug-and-play compatibility, often requiring no soldering. High-end models include galvanic isolation to protect controllers from electrical noise in industrial environments. Modularity is another critical feature—stackable designs allow multiple boards to operate simultaneously. Some boards integrate wireless communication (Wi-Fi/Bluetooth) or real-time clock (RTC) modules, eliminating the need for external components.

Application Areas

In factory automation, expansion boards enable PLCs to connect with additional sensors or actuators. Robotics applications use them to add servo controllers or encoder interfaces. Consumer electronics prototyping heavily relies on expansion boards for rapid testing. Energy management systems utilize them for data acquisition from multiple power meters or environmental sensors.

Maintenance and Precautions

Avoid exposing boards to moisture or extreme temperatures. Periodically inspect connectors for corrosion, especially in humid environments. Use anti-static wrist straps during installation to prevent ESD damage. Firmware updates may be required for smart expansion boards. Always disconnect power before adding/removing modules to avoid short circuits.

B2B Procurement Guide

Bulk buyers should verify long-term availability to avoid production disruptions. Request samples to test compatibility with existing systems. Key suppliers include industrial brands like Advantech and Phoenix Contact, as well as open-source specialists like Seeed Studio. Consider boards with vendor-provided APIs or libraries for easier software integration. For critical applications, opt for models with extended temperature ratings (-40°C to +85°C) and MTBF certifications.
